引言
内容管理系统(CMS)作为网站内容管理和发布的基石,经历了从简单到复杂、从传统到智能的演变过程。近年来,随着前端技术的发展,前端框架在CMS系统中的应用越来越广泛,为内容管理带来了新的可能性。本文将深入探讨前端框架如何重构CMS系统,推动内容管理进入新篇章。
前端框架的兴起
1.1 技术背景
随着互联网的快速发展,网站内容和形式日益丰富,传统的CMS系统逐渐暴露出一些问题,如开发效率低、用户体验差、扩展性差等。为了解决这些问题,前端框架应运而生。
1.2 常见的前端框架
目前,市场上主流的前端框架有Vue.js、React、Angular等。这些框架具有以下特点:
- 组件化开发:将页面拆分为多个可复用的组件,提高开发效率。
- 响应式设计:支持多种设备访问,提升用户体验。
- 数据绑定:简化数据操作,提高开发效率。
- 生态丰富:拥有庞大的社区和丰富的插件,方便扩展。
前端框架在CMS系统中的应用
2.1 提高开发效率
前端框架通过组件化和模块化开发,降低了开发难度,提高了开发效率。开发者可以专注于业务逻辑,而无需花费大量时间在页面布局和样式上。
2.2 优化用户体验
前端框架支持响应式设计,使网站能够适应不同设备和屏幕尺寸,提升用户体验。同时,通过数据绑定和异步加载等技术,提高了页面加载速度和交互性。
2.3 增强扩展性
前端框架的模块化设计,使得系统易于扩展。开发者可以根据需求,快速添加或修改功能模块,提高系统的可维护性和可扩展性。
前端框架重构CMS系统的案例
3.1 基于Vue.js的Lin-CMS
Lin-CMS是一款基于Vue.js的内容管理系统框架,具有以下特点:
- 前后端分离:提高开发效率,降低耦合度。
- 模块化设计:方便扩展和定制。
- 可视化配置:简化配置过程,降低学习成本。
3.2 基于React的SpringBoot+vue+Iview CMS系统
该系统采用SpringBoot作为后端框架,Vue.js和Iview作为前端框架,具有以下特点:
- 权限控制:实现用户权限管理,确保数据安全。
- 内容管理:支持多种内容类型,如文章、图片、视频等。
- 自定义模板:方便用户根据需求定制页面样式。
总结
前端框架在CMS系统中的应用,为内容管理带来了新的机遇和挑战。通过前端框架,我们可以提高开发效率、优化用户体验、增强系统扩展性,推动内容管理进入新篇章。未来,随着前端技术的不断发展,前端框架在CMS系统中的应用将更加广泛,为内容管理带来更多可能性。